Graph Intelligence for Networked Physical Systems

Many of the systems studied here are naturally relational: base stations interact through interference and topology, farms are organised through sensors, valves, gateways, and terrain, and infrastructure assets influence one another across space and time. Graph intelligence focuses on learning directly from this structure rather than treating it as unstructured data.

This creates a strong foundation for tasks such as greenfield site planning, adaptive sensor placement, capacity estimation, interference-aware control, and distributed resource coordination. The broader objective is to use graph-based learning to build models that are more scalable, more physically meaningful, and better aligned with real networked environments.
